import * as asn1js from "asn1js"; import { getParametersValue } from "pvutils"; //************************************************************************************** /** * Class from RFC5280 */ export default class PolicyMapping { //********************************************************************************** /** * Constructor for PolicyMapping class * @param {Object} [parameters={}] * @property {Object} [schema] asn1js parsed value */ constructor(parameters = {}) { //region Internal properties of the object /** * @type {string} * @description issuerDomainPolicy */ this.issuerDomainPolicy = getParametersValue(parameters, "issuerDomainPolicy", PolicyMapping.defaultValues("issuerDomainPolicy")); /** * @type {string} * @description subjectDomainPolicy */ this.subjectDomainPolicy = getParametersValue(parameters, "subjectDomainPolicy", PolicyMapping.defaultValues("subjectDomainPolicy")); //endregion //region If input argument array contains "schema" for this object if("schema" in parameters) this.fromSchema(parameters.schema); //endregion } //********************************************************************************** /** * Return default values for all class members * @param {string} memberName String name for a class member */ static defaultValues(memberName) { switch(memberName) { case "issuerDomainPolicy": return ""; case "subjectDomainPolicy": return ""; default: throw new Error(`Invalid member name for PolicyMapping class: ${memberName}`); } } //********************************************************************************** /** * Return value of asn1js schema for current class * @param {Object} parameters Input parameters for the schema * @returns {Object} asn1js schema object */ static schema(parameters = {}) { //PolicyMapping ::= SEQUENCE { // issuerDomainPolicy CertPolicyId, // subjectDomainPolicy CertPolicyId } /** * @type {Object} * @property {string} [blockName] * @property {string} [issuerDomainPolicy] * @property {string} [subjectDomainPolicy] */ const names = getParametersValue(parameters, "names", {}); return (new asn1js.Sequence({ name: (names.blockName || ""), value: [ new asn1js.ObjectIdentifier({ name: (names.issuerDomainPolicy || "") }), new asn1js.ObjectIdentifier({ name: (names.subjectDomainPolicy || "") }) ] })); } //********************************************************************************** /** * Convert parsed asn1js object into current class * @param {!Object} schema */ fromSchema(schema) { //region Check the schema is valid const asn1 = asn1js.compareSchema(schema, schema, PolicyMapping.schema({ names: { issuerDomainPolicy: "issuerDomainPolicy", subjectDomainPolicy: "subjectDomainPolicy" } }) ); if(asn1.verified === false) throw new Error("Object's schema was not verified against input data for PolicyMapping"); //endregion //region Get internal properties from parsed schema this.issuerDomainPolicy = asn1.result.issuerDomainPolicy.valueBlock.toString(); this.subjectDomainPolicy = asn1.result.subjectDomainPolicy.valueBlock.toString(); //endregion } //********************************************************************************** /** * Convert current object to asn1js object and set correct values * @returns {Object} asn1js object */ toSchema() { //region Construct and return new ASN.1 schema for this object return (new asn1js.Sequence({ value: [ new asn1js.ObjectIdentifier({ value: this.issuerDomainPolicy }), new asn1js.ObjectIdentifier({ value: this.subjectDomainPolicy }) ] })); //endregion } //********************************************************************************** /** * Convertion for the class to JSON object * @returns {Object} */ toJSON() { return { issuerDomainPolicy: this.issuerDomainPolicy, subjectDomainPolicy: this.subjectDomainPolicy }; } //********************************************************************************** } //**************************************************************************************
